As a key transmission component, high-precision bidirectional couplings play an irreplaceable role in the field of industrial automation and precision equipment. Its core advantage is that it can achieve accurate transmission of bidirectional torque while maintaining low vibration, low noise and high reliability under complex working conditions.
In the field of industrial robots, high-precision bidirectional couplings are widely used in joint drive systems. By accurately compensating for axial and angular deviations, the positioning accuracy of the end effector of the robotic arm is ensured to reach the micron level. Especially in refined operation scenarios such as welding and assembly, its stable performance has greatly improved production efficiency and product quality.
In the field of aerospace, high-precision bidirectional couplings are often used in the transmission chain of flight control systems, such as aileron servos and rudder adjustment devices. Such applications require that the transmission components not only have extremely high precision, but also need to adapt to extreme environments such as sudden temperature changes and high-frequency vibrations. Through the combination of special materials and precision processing technology, high-precision bidirectional couplings can effectively eliminate transmission gaps and ensure the accurate execution of flight control system instructions, which is of decisive significance to flight safety.
In addition, in precision medical equipment such as the rotating rack of CT scanners, high-precision bidirectional couplings ensure the real-time and resolution of image acquisition through the bidirectional linkage of synchronous motors and detectors, providing reliable technical support for medical diagnosis. With the iterative upgrade of intelligent manufacturing technology, high-precision bidirectional couplings have also shown broad application prospects in emerging fields such as semiconductor manufacturing and new energy equipment, and continue to promote the development of modern industry towards higher precision and higher efficiency.
